Import Existing Project
If you have already used MxControlCenter or MxEasy, you can import an existing MxControlCenter.ini file from the MxControlCenter or the MxEasy.ndb camera list from an MxEasy installation. In both cases, the cameras already integrated in the MxControlCenter (MxCC) or MxEasy are automatically transferred to the MxManagementCenter with their access data.
Furthermore, it is possible to quickly integrate a large number of cameras and camera groups into MxMC using a manually created list in .mxu format. You need to adhere to specific rules for the format when creating the list in order to correctly export the contents of the *.mxu file.
Importing Configurations From MxControlCenter
When importing an MxCC file, the following is taken into account:
- The layouts defined in MxCC are created as groups in MxMC.
- The background layouts from MxCC, including the background graphics and definitions of the camera symbols, are transferred to the Graphic view of the associated group.
- If a global password has been assigned, this will be entered for all cameras that do not have a user name.
- For each hyperlink used, a softbutton is created in MxMC.
- Furthermore, the tree structure from MxCC is shown in the Device bar and file servers configured in MxCC are created in the MxMC settings.
- Open the Welcome Wizard from the File > Welcome menu.
Program call:
Welcome Wizard
- Click on Import MxCC. Decide if the current project should be saved.
- Import the desired INI file.
Importing Configurations From MxEasy
- Open the Welcome Wizard from the File > Welcome menu.
Program call:
Welcome Wizard
- Click on Import MxEasy. Decide if the current project should be saved.
- Import the desired NDB file.
Importing MXU Files
Using a manually created list in .mxu format, you can quickly add a large number of cameras and camera groups. You need to adhere to various formatting rules when creating the list in order to correctly export the contents of the *.mxu file.
Important: This list does not replace the project import, during which program settings, such as settings for the cameras and camera groups with assigned layouts, are imported.
- Click on Import MXU to import cameras and camera groups in the Welcome wizard. You can save the existing project, if necessary.
- Open the *.mxu file.
- Decide whether the cameras and groups from the *.mxu file should replace the entire configuration or they should be only added.
